#a95708, answered

What color is #a95708?

#a95708 is a dark electric orange, closest to Sienna (ΔE2000 8). It sits at 29° on the hue wheel with 91% saturation and 35% lightness, which reads as warm.

What is the RGB value of #a95708?

rgb(169, 87, 8) — 169 red, 87 green and 8 blue out of 255, or 66.3% / 34.1% / 3.1% by channel.

Is #a95708 a light or a dark color?

It is a dark color. Relative luminance is 0.1527 and perceived brightness is 45%, so white text on it reaches 5.18:1.

Should I use black or white text on #a95708?

White. It scores 5.18:1 against #a95708, versus 4.05:1 for black — AA at any size.

What is the complementary color of #a95708?

#085AA9 sits directly opposite on the wheel. Softer options are the split-complements #08A9A7 and #080AA9, which give the same contrast with far less vibration.

What colors go well with #a95708?

For interface work: #FAF7F4 as the surface, #EDD6C0 for borders, #9B724B for secondary text, #0484AD as an accent and #7A3F06 for hover and pressed states. For a palette, the analogous pair #A9080A and #A9A708 stays calm, while #085AA9 is the loudest partner.

What is #a95708 in CMYK for printing?

cmyk(0%, 49%, 95%, 34%). This is a screen-to-ink approximation — a color this saturated sits outside most CMYK gamuts and will print duller than it looks here.

Is #a95708 warm or cool?

Warm — it scores 0 on a scale where 0 is the warmest orange and 100 the coolest azure. Nudged warmer it becomes #C15C09; nudged cooler, #AB1A06.
